The 3rd place achieved by China, equivalent to his first podium with Ferrari, seemed to be the message of a better feeling with the car for Lewis Hamilton after an absolutely forgettable 2025. However, the last two races in Suzuka and Miami recorded a drop in performance from the seven-time world champion, who also stated that he encountered problems with the simulator. The real headaches, according to a former Formula 1 driver like Ralf Schumacher, would be different.

The replacement with another Englishman

According to the German, who appeared on the Backstage Boxengasse podcast, it would be time for Hamilton to retire from F1, with the seat left free at Ferrari possibly being occupied by a driver raised in Maranello’s Driver Academy like Oliver Bearman: “Hamilton is obviously in a better position this year, but he probably won’t have any chance against Leclerc in the long term. It is so – he said – Alonso and Hamilton have had wonderful moments in Formula 1, but I think it’s time for them to leave the cockpit at the end of the year and give space to the young drivers. Hamilton has achieved everything he could. He is one of the most successful drivers ever, if not the greatest, as the English would say. He deserves it. He’s done for this year. This comeback has been fantastic, but I believe everything has an end. That’s why I say now that I think it’s time to give space to the younger generation. Oliver Bearman deserves the chance to drive the Ferrari. I also believe that, if given the opportunity, he could compete with Charles Leclerc. It wouldn’t be easy for Leclerc.”

A younger grid

Schumacher added further personal considerations on the possibility of seeing Bearman arrive at Ferrari, who has already said he is ready for this big step forward despite the team’s intention to continue this season with the current line-up: “They want to keep the Lewis Hamilton brand. There are many promising young drivers coming from Formula 2 who deserve a chance. I hope the starting grid will be a bit younger next year. Bearman definitely deserves the chance to drive a Ferrari.”
